The first time I entered the subway in Beijing I immediately loved this handheld thingies which are perfectly aligned and could easily be used as frame / tunnel. Unfortunately I have to admit that shooting on the subway is rather a tough one. I yesterday saw a sign saying it's forbidden, too. But that I don't care about. It's more like people recognize that you are observing your environment because you want to shoot them. Maybe it's a natural thing because you stay over a longer period of time together with the same people and you steadily hold your camera and keep observing. This is a whole different story out on the street because there is this dynamic element to it most of the time. Even when you keep on standing in the same spot, most people keep on moving. Maybe I haven't just obtained the right Ninja skills yet. But it's definitely next level shooting on the subway when it comes to your comfort zone.
